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0056 93329105881 813322520 95564015
5794307077 744 209
5794307077 744 209
63 3050755 8366 47974466028
All about undefined
Interested in learning more?
5794307077 744 209
63 3050755 8366 47974466028
See more
6929 69732406211
765 5252949 573697036 138
See more
53 22475 5541183
372452 99344 548902 410179
See more